
About missoula
in motion
Missoula In Motion (MIM) is a program of the Transportation Division of the City of Missoula's Development Services founded in 1997. MIM encourages the many sustainable transportation options available to individuals and workplaces through fiscally responsible strategies and best practice programs.
MISSION
Our mission at Missoula In Motion is to increase the use of sustainable transportation in and around Missoula.
VISION
Our vision for Missoula is a connected transportation network that is safe, accessible, affordable, and desirable for everyone and contributes to a cleaner environment, healthier individuals and a more vibrant place to live, work and play.
​
EVALUATION
Missoula In Motion undergoes periodic internal review to ensure programs and services are not only meeting the needs of Missoulians, but are deploying Transportation Options effectively. Missoula In Motion releases an annual report and presents to the Missoula City Council, partners and stakeholders regularly.
